“More Oceanfront Properties” – Trump Makes Light of Climate Change in Viral Interview

In a now-viral clip from a livestreamed interview with Elon Musk, Donald Trump made comments about climate change that seemed to suggest that global warming was not a serious threat.

An interview hosted online by Elon Musk was delayed by over forty minutes, but after the technical issues were resolved, Donald Trump sat down with the billionaire CEO to discuss his views on the environment, the assassination attempt, and immigration.

While the entire interview included statements from Donald Trump that had fact-checkers working overtime, one of his comments has received significant backlash as he attempted to downplay the severity of climate change.

“You’ll Have More Oceanfront Property” When Sea Levels Rise, Trump Says

“You know the biggest threat is not global warming when the ocean’s going to rise one-eighth of an inch in the next 400 years, and you’ll have more oceanfront property. The biggest threat is not that,” Trump told Musk.

It’s not the first time the former president has joked that rising sea levels are a good thing. Last year, he brushed off the notion that it was a problem, making fun of scientists who show concern about it.

“The world is going to be destroyed because the oceans are going to rise 1/100 of an inch within the next 300 years,” Trump said sarcastically. “It’s going to kill everybody? It’s going to create more oceanfront property; that’s what it’s going to do.”

Evidence Contradicts Trump’s Statistics

Trump’s figures are a gross underestimation, as evidence shows that sea levels have risen up to eight inches over the past century. Climate experts say that in more recent years, the rise is happening much more quickly.

Musk Did Not Argue Trump’s Claims

Elon Musk, who is the CEO of Tesla and an advocate for electric vehicles, has previously said that climate change is “a major risk.” He did not challenge Trump’s assertions that the issue was not something to worry about.

Trump continued, saying there was a more significant risk that people should be preparing for: nuclear warming.

“Nobody talks about nuclear…the problem…the biggest problem we have in the whole world, it’s not global warming, it’s nuclear warming,” Trump said.

Experts have expressed confusion about what nuclear warming is, about which Trump has warned in the past. Some speculate that he is referencing the possibility of nuclear war.

“All it takes is one mad man and you’re going to have a problem, the likes of which the world has never seen,” Trump said. He also referred to the world “nuclear” as the “n-word,” saying it was one of “two n-words,” and that “you don’t mention either one of them.”

As for climate change, Trump claims that he considers himself an environmentalist, referencing policies he put in place regarding the environment while he was president. He was not specific about those policies.

“The environmentalists talk about all this nonsense in many cases. I’ve become an environmentalist also, I guess in my own way because I have done a good job with the environment,” said the former president.

Despite Trump’s claims that the environmental effects of global warming are nothing to be concerned about, the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A) warns that the opposite is true. As sea levels continue to rise, the NOAA expects more severe flooding in coastal areas, including Florida, where Trump owns a large amount of property.
